WUSC in Asia
WUSC is currently active in four countries in South and Southeast Asia: Sri Lanka, Afghanistan, Nepal and Vietnam. View the map. As one of the largest Canadian development NGOs in Sri Lanka, we are active throughout the country with an emphasis on delivering vocational training in conflict and tsunami-affected areas as well as reducing poverty and social exclusion in plantation communities. In Afghanistan, WUSC is using its vocational training expertise to help women widowed by decades-long conflict acquire employable skills and enter non-traditional jobs. Through our Uniterra volunteer cooperation program, we are present in Nepal as well as Vietnam. Uniterra is a joint initiative of WUSC and the Centre for International Studies and Cooperation (CECI). |
